  • Abstract
    This article reviews the different components, conductors, semiconductive shields, insulation, sheaths, and jackets, that make up extruded, high-voltage cables. The different types of conductors are described as are the different insulation systems that are available for medium and HV cables. There is a comparison of the two main insulators used in extruded HV cables, EPR, and XLPE. Each material has some properties that are better than those of the other material.
